小编Eng*_*adi的帖子

CSS:是否可以将字体大小调整为div宽度?

我有一个宽度为70%的div,这就是我想要做的:

  • 在那个div中放了一些词
  • 调整字体大小,使这些单词占据所有div宽度

只有css这可能吗?这是我的代码:

.parent {
  width:70%;
  height:auto;
  min-height:100px;
  background:red;
  font-size:10vw;
}
Run Code Online (Sandbox Code Playgroud)
Please help me to change the font-size dynamically to the parent class
<hr>
<div class="parent">
  This Text
</div>
Run Code Online (Sandbox Code Playgroud)

注意:div 大小是响应的,这很重要.提前致谢!

html css fonts font-size responsive-design

21
推荐指数
2
解决办法
3万
查看次数

模拟在输入文本上按[enter]键

我的代码完美地改变了页面加载时自动输入的值,并且它之间有延迟.

但是还有另外一个问题,当我试图模拟按下[enter]输入上的键时,它不起作用,它提交表单并重新加载我的页面.

我如何模拟按下[enter]输入中的键而不提交表单而不重新加载我的页面?我用纯javascriptjQuery

这是我的脚本:

var form  	= document.querySelectorAll("._k3t69");
var input 	= document.querySelectorAll("._7uiwk._qy55y");
var message = "Replacement..." ; 
var maxMsg  = 3 ;
var delay 	= 2.5 * 1000 ; // 2.5 Seconds

var j = 0, k = 0;
function setValue(){
  if( j == maxMsg || j == input.length) {
  	clearInterval(looping)
  } else {
		input[j++].value = message ;
    //And then simulate pressing enter key ON THE INPUT, not sumbit the form
    form[k++].submit();
  } …
Run Code Online (Sandbox Code Playgroud)

html javascript input keypress

5
推荐指数
1
解决办法
9306
查看次数

如果另一个数组具有相同的元素,则连接数组

我有两个数组

var arrayA = ["a", "a", "b", "b", "a", "c"];
var arrayB = [10, 20, 3, 2, 20, 5];
Run Code Online (Sandbox Code Playgroud)

如您所见,arrayA[0], arrayA[1], arrayA[4]具有相同的元素(也是arrayA[2], arrayA[3]相同的).

所以基于上面的例子,我想要arrayB[0], arrayB[1], arrayB[4]总结,arrayB[2], arrayB[3]也是.

期望输出

arrayA = ["a", "b", "c"];
arrayB = [50, 5, 5];
Run Code Online (Sandbox Code Playgroud)

如果arrayA具有基于arrayA索引的相同元素,则可以对arrayB元素求和吗?并且有一个Lodash/Underscore功能来做到这一点?

javascript arrays underscore.js lodash

3
推荐指数
1
解决办法
123
查看次数

占位符:绝对位置不适用于负最高值

我有一个输入,它有一个占位符。我已经成功地设置了占位符的样式,但是当我尝试将占位符移动到顶部时,当输入聚焦时它不起作用,我使用的是绝对位置,并且顶部位置具有负值。

这是我的代码:

<style>
    #wrapper {
      padding:40px;
      position:relative;
    }

    input {
      display:block;
      position : relative;
    }

    input::-webkit-input-placeholder {
      color: red;
      position:absolute;
    }

    input:focus::-webkit-input-placeholder {
      top:-20px;
      color:blue;
    }
</style>

<div id="wrapper">
  <input type="text" placeholder="Engkus Kusnadi">
</div>
Run Code Online (Sandbox Code Playgroud)

这是我的小提琴: https: //jsfiddle.net/su2roqvc/2/

我缺少什么?

html css

2
推荐指数
1
解决办法
4200
查看次数

是什么意思$('element',this.el)[0]?

现在我学习了Backbone和Marionette,我读了一些教程,发现了一些我不懂的代码.这是代码:

$('element',this.el)[0]
Run Code Online (Sandbox Code Playgroud)

我知道jQuery一点点.我知道this关键字,我知道$('element')关键字,但不了解代码,请大家告诉我这个.

javascript jquery backbone.js marionette

0
推荐指数
1
解决办法
392
查看次数